Block

#21,689,518
Block Number
21,689,518 @ 05/16/2025, 19:39:40
Status
Finalized
ID
0x014af4ae643009664f4050af31306a08217a91263458473cd88fbc1aa2c8f4e4
Transactions
Gas Used
3367783/40000000 (8.42% Used)
Total Score
2,118,234,655 (+98)
Rewards
13.42 VTHO